To grasp the severity of the situation, it's essential to understand what these forms entail and why they are so critical. The Employer's Report Of Work Related Accident, for instance, is a detailed document that outlines the circumstances surrounding a work-related injury, including the nature of the accident, the extent of the injuries, and the steps taken by the employer to address the situation. This form is a crucial component of the workers' compensation process, as it helps determine the eligibility and extent of benefits for the injured employee.

Another key form is the U1a, which is used to report and verify the details of work-related injuries. This form is typically filled out by the employer and submitted to the relevant authorities, where it is reviewed and processed as part of the workers' compensation claim. The U1a form contains sensitive information about the employee, including their personal details, medical history, and employment status.
